Overview
The Individuals/Foundations Group provides accounting, tax compliance and planning, legal, trust administration, business management, financial management, treasury, insurance, and technology services to the enterprises of two wealthy families, including business entities, trusts, individuals and foundations.The Senior Accountant position reports to the Group Leader and Sr. Manager of the Individual/Foundation Group and provides a unique opportunity for a qualified candidate to leverage his or her accounting, financial analysis and project management within the group.
Key Duties & Responsibilities- Maintenance and review of general ledgers, including preparation of accounting entries for the day-to-day transactions and other activity.
- Preparation and review of electronic tax work papers and tax returns for individuals, foundations and partnerships, including analysis of tax issues.
- Preparation and review of financial analysis such as tax projections, cash flow and liquidity planning and budgets.
- Preparing and maintaining periodic reports, including personal financial statements for family members, private foundation financial reports, summaries of property expenses, valuable articles and insurance policies.
- 5-7 years’ work experience working in accounting preferably the high net worth area.
- Relevant undergraduate degree required.
- CPA preferred.
-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office, specifically Excel.
